You are on page 1of 1

6/10/23, 7:56 AM API Testing Overview

API Testing Overview

In SQL, you can use regular expressions to validate an email address. While different
database systems have varying support for regular expressions, I'll provide a general
example that should work in most cases.

Here's an example SQL query that validates an email address format using a regular
expression pattern:

sql Copy code

SELECT email
FROM YourTableName
WHERE email REGEXP '^[A-Za-z0-9._%+-]+@[A-Za-z0-9.-]+\.[A-Za-z]{2,}$';

Replace `YourTableName` with the actual name of your table, and `email` with the column
name that stores the email addresses.

In the query, the `REGEXP` operator is used to compare the `email` column against the
provided regular expression pattern. The pattern `^[A-Za-z0-9._%+-]+@[A-Za-z0-
9.-]+\.[A-Za-z]{2,}$` represents a basic email format validation.

Here's a breakdown of the regular expression pattern:

• `^`: Start of the string.

• `[A-Za-z0-9._%+-]+`: One or more letters, digits, dots, underscores, percent signs, plus

signs, or hyphens.
• `@`: The "@" symbol.

• `[A-Za-z0-9.-]+`: One or more letters, digits, dots, or hyphens.

• `\.`: A literal dot (escaped with a backslash).


• `[A-Za-z]{2,}`: Two or more letters.

• `$`: End of the string.

This pattern checks for basic email format validation, but it does not guarantee that the
email address is valid or exists in reality. It checks if the email address follows a standard
format.

Note that the exact syntax and regular expression capabilities may vary depending on the
database system you are using. Make sure to refer to your database system's
documentation for specific details on regular expression usage.

Send a message.

Free Research Preview. ChatGPT may produce inaccurate information about people, places, or facts. ChatGPT May 24 Version

https://chat.openai.com 1/1

You might also like